NVIDIA configures GTX 1000 series notebooks for VR games

For the first time last year, NVIDIA began experimenting with porting desktop-grade graphics chips for desktops to laptops using the Maxwell-based GTX 980 chipset. This shows that the company is working hard to develop this new technology, and now NVIDIA is porting its GTX 1000 series chipset to the notebook. Be careful! This is not the previous M-series mobile graphics card or notebook-specific graphics card, but the real GTX 1060, GTX 1070 and GTX 1080 graphics cards installed in the laptop.

NVIDIA configures GTX 1000 series notebooks for VR games

NVIDIA project manager Mark Aevermann explained in the media ventilation session of the new graphics processor: "We have been planning this for many years." In the past, NVIDIA did not implement this technology, but now the company can already A more efficient Pascal-based graphics chipset is directly applied to laptops. Their use is almost identical to the desktop system, but the clock frequency is slightly lower when the GTX 1060 graphics chipset is installed inside the notebook. To prove the effect, NVIDIA demonstrated the effect of running War Machine 4 on a laptop with a GTX 1080 graphics card with a resolution of 4K, 60 frames per second. Aevermann said: "This is very powerful and very advanced."

In the test system, GTX 1080 has 2560 CUDA display cores, running at 1733MHz, and equipped with 8GB GDDR5X memory. The GTX 1070 graphics card, as an alternative to the 980M, has 2048 CUDA cores built in, running at 1645MHz and equipped with 8GB of GDDR5 memory. GTX 1060 graphics card, used to replace the 970M display chipset, built-in 1280 CUDA core, running at 1670MHz, equipped with 6GB GDDR5 memory. NVIDIA's running test compares the performance of GTX 1060, GTX 1070 and GTX 1080 graphics cards on desktop systems and notebook systems, and the results are very satisfactory, especially in some test projects, the GTX 1080 graphics card in the notebook runs beyond The desktop version of GTX 1080. The performance of these new notebook graphics chips has improved by at least 150% compared to previous M-series mobile display chipsets.

Obviously, NVIDIA has invested heavily in gaming notebooks, and the company is also very optimistic about the industry outlook and performance of the Pascal architecture. In NVIDIA's new graphics processor media event, Aevermann revealed that the gaming notebook has a 20 million installation base, compared to the PlayStaTIon 4 with a 52 million installation base and the Xbox One installation base of 29 million. NVIDIA expects that while gaming console sales continue to increase, gaming notebook sales will increase by 30% this year, and the company's new GTX 1000 series graphics cards will boost sales of gaming notebooks.

As we all know, NVIDIA's Pascal architecture graphics card performance and performance are very good, and will be successfully ported to notebooks. Notebook gamers using the new framed graphics card will receive 30% of the game life. NVIDIA has also adjusted the battery boost technology to improve the difference in frame counts when there is no external power supply.

NVIDIA also promises that these new graphics chipsets are fully compatible with VR games. Of course, for the GTX 1080 chipset, support for VR is clearly not a problem, but it may be somewhat far-fetched for the GTX 1060 chipset. At NVIDIA's event, I experienced a VR game using the GTX 1060 chipset connected to the HTC Vive helmet. NVIDIA only demonstrated a fairly basic boxing game. However, when running a game that relies more on graphics chips, a higher-end graphics card is required to get a good gaming experience. Therefore, the promise that the GTX 1060 graphics card can support VR games is only for some games with low quality, or that it is considered to reduce the picture effect. At the same time, the GTX 1000 series chipset can support VR games and is also possible to use external AC power. The company does not promise to run VR games smoothly when using the battery.

Every major OEM and system manufacturer will launch notebooks based on Pascal architecture graphics cards, including Lenovo, EVGA, Aliens, Asus, MSI, HP, Acer. , Razer and many other companies. Pascal may not be the most suitable graphics card architecture for gaming notebooks, but it can dramatically improve graphics performance under limited conditions. NVIDIA expects OEMs to build 18mm thin, 1.8kg notebooks with GTX 1060 graphics cards, like the 15-inch MacBook Pro with a perfect form factor, but NVIDIA doesn't suggest any new graphics chips. The group is associated with Apple and Microsoft.

By using the GTX 1000 Series graphics card, OEMs will be able to easily create notebooks that support 120Hz displays. And soon the GTX 1080 graphics card will unlock the overclocking option, which is expected to increase by about 10%. After a few months, the overclocking capabilities of the GTX 1070 and GTX 1060 chipsets will also be unlocked. Notebook manufacturers will be able to develop monster-level laptops with SLI multi-graphics cross-fire, and will introduce water-cooled devices into their laptops. Of course, the size of notebooks may change accordingly. Major manufacturers have begun to introduce notebook products using GTX 1080, GTX 1070 and GTX 1060 graphics cards, and will continue to upgrade the hardware in the coming months, hoping to achieve sales breakthroughs in the year-end promotions. .
